Custom window services involve professional installation, replacement, and repair of a wide variety of window types to improve both the appearance and functionality of a property. These services ensure that windows are properly fitted, sealed, and secure, helping to enhance energy efficiency and prevent drafts or leaks. Whether a homeowner is upgrading outdated windows or fixing damaged ones, experienced contractors can handle the entire process, from selecting the right style to ensuring a precise fit. This expertise can make a significant difference in the overall comfort and aesthetic of a home.

Many common problems can be addressed through custom window services, including broken glass, foggy or cloudy panes, difficulty opening or closing windows, and drafts that lead to higher energy bills. Damaged frames or seals can also cause water leaks and reduce insulation. By replacing or repairing these components, service providers help restore the window’s performance and appearance. Custom solutions are often necessary when standard-sized windows don’t fit unique architectural features or when homeowners want specific styles that aren’t readily available off the shelf.

Properties that typically benefit from custom window services include older homes with non-standard window sizes, new constructions with unique design requirements, and properties experiencing issues with existing windows. Residential homes, especially those with historical or distinctive architectural details, often require tailored window solutions to maintain their character. Additionally, commercial buildings, rental properties, and custom-designed residences may all need specialized window work to meet aesthetic preferences or functional needs. The overview below groups typical Custom Window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Ozark, MO.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ine window repairs in Ozark, MO range from $100 to $300. Many minor fixes, such as replacing a broken sash or hardware, fall within this band. Fewer projects reach the upper end of this range, which is reserved for more involved repairs.

Single Window Replacement - Replacing a single standard window usually costs between $250 and $600. Local contractors often handle these projects efficiently, with most jobs landing in the middle of this range. Larger or more complex replacements can exceed $700, but are less common.

Full Window Installation - Installing multiple windows or upgrading entire rooms typically costs from $2,000 to $5,000 or more. Many projects fall into the mid-range, while extensive or custom installations may push costs higher, depending on window types and home size.

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Custom window services for large or intricate projects can range from $5,000 to $15,000+ in Ozark, MO. These jobs are less frequent and involve specialized materials or designs, with costs varying based on scope and complexity.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ing service providers for custom window projects, it’s important to consider their experience with similar types of work. Homeowners should look for local contractors who have a proven track record of handling projects comparable in scope and style. This can help ensure that the contractor understands the specific demands of custom window installations or replacements, and has the necessary skills to deliver results that meet expectations. Asking about past projects or reviewing portfolios can provide insight into a contractor’s familiarity with the work at hand and their ability to handle unique or complex window services.

Clear, written expectations are essential when choosing a local contractor for custom window services. Homeowners should seek providers who can articulate their process, materials, and what the project will entail in a straightforward manner. Having detailed, written descriptions of the scope of work hel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ures everyone is aligned on what will be delivered. It’s beneficial to request a written estimate or proposal that outlines the specifics of the project, including any warranties or guarantees, so that expectations are transparent from the outset.

Reputation and communication are key factors in selecting a reliable service provider. Reputable local contractors often have references or reviews from previous clients that can be verified to gauge their professionalism and quality of work. Good communication involves responsiveness, clarity, and a willingness to answer questions throughout the process. Homeowners should prioritize service providers who are approachable and transparent, making it easier to address concerns or adjustments as the project progresses.
